Fox News programming continues to lead in the cable news ratings race.
FNC is home to eight of the top 10 cable news shows for the month of October, both in total viewers and among adults 25-54.
Back in his original 9 p.m. timeslot, Sean Hannity had the No. 1 cable news show in October, both in total viewers and the A25-54 demo, and he won those respective categories by rather large margins. Hannity was also up double-digits versus October 2016 (up +15 percent in total viewers and +27 percent in the 25-54 demo).
Here’s a look at the top 10 cable news programs for October, both in total viewers and among adults 25-54.
Total Viewers:
- Hannity (3,198,000)
- Tucker Carlson Tonight (2,824,000)
- The Rachel Maddow Show (2,503,000)
- Special Report With Bret Baier (2,339,000)
- The Five (2,308,000)
- The Story With Martha MacCallum (2,158,000)
- Fox News Tonight – 10 p.m. (2,003,000)
- Last Word With Lawrence O’Donnell (1,906,000)
- America’s Newsroom (1,905,000)
- Outnumbered (1,793,000)
Adults 25-54:
- Hannity (686,000)
- Tucker Carlson Tonight (581,000)
- The Rachel Maddow Show (558,000)
- Fox News Tonight – 10 p.m. (468,000)
- The Story With Martha MacCallum (450,000)
- Special Report With Bret Baier (448,000)
- The Five (443,000)
- Last Word With Lawrence O’Donnell (409,000)
- America’s Newsroom (401,000)
- Fox & Friends (400,000)
Anderson Cooper 360 was CNN’s top show for October (No. 25 in total viewers / No. 11 among A25-54).
Lou Dobbs Tonight was Fox Business’s top show for October (No. 48 in total viewers / No. 60 among A25-54)
Forensic Files was HLN’s top show for October (No. 49 in total viewers / No. 48 among A25-54 )
Shark Tank was CNBC’s top show for October (No. 50 in total viewers / No. 49 among A25-54)
Morning Shows
Total Viewers:
- Fox & Friends (1,647,000)
- Morning Joe (1,019,000)
- New Day (656,000)
Adults 25-54:
- Fox & Friends (400,000)
- New Day (243,000)
- Morning Joe (237,000)
